RSS 272 projects tagged "Assembly"

Download No website Updated 12 Feb 2011 LSE/OS

Screenshot
Pop 35.00
Vit 1.42

LSE/OS is a nanokernel based operating system running on the x86_32 architecture.

Download Website Updated 09 Aug 2012 HelenOS

Screenshot
Pop 77.77
Vit 7.84

HelenOS is a microkernel-based multiserver operating system designed from scratch. By decomposing the operating system functionality into tens of isolated but intensively communicating userspace servers, it provides a computing environment that has several virtues such as flexibility, increased robustness, well defined explicit interfaces, and smaller complexity of individual components. HelenOS does not aim to be another clone of Unix or some other legacy system and is not POSIX-compliant (even though it may seem POSIX-similar at times). Instead, the goal has been to design it according to what is the most elegant and right thing to do. What makes HelenOS unique among the other multiserver operating systems is its multiplatform and multiprocessor microkernel. It will run on seven different processor architectures ranging from a 32-bit uniprocessor little-endian ARMv4 to a 64-bit multicore big-endian UltraSPARC T1.

No download Website Updated 13 Mar 2006 mbldr

Screenshot
Pop 22.00
Vit 54.45

mbldr (Master Boot LoaDeR) is a boot loader which fits into the first sector of an HDD (MBR). It allows the user to choose which partition to boot and is intended to replace an MBR that comes with DOS/Windows (fdisk /mbr). It may boot OSes above the 1024th cylinder, and Linux and BSD are also supported. mbldr is based on OS Boot Select (OS-BS) project by Thomas wolfRAM.

No download Website Updated 06 Mar 2006 HeavenOS

Screenshot
Pop 27.35
Vit 1.00

HeavenOS is an original, alternative 32-bit operating system for Intel 80386 compatible processors. It is made with NASM (The Netwide Assembler), and is not intended to compare to modern operating systems, but to try to get the best features and discover better ways to do things. It is intended to be a simple and pratical platform for development, running with a small amount of code.

No download Website Updated 27 Feb 2006 DSLinux

Screenshot
Pop 18.11
Vit 54.58

DSLinux is a port of Linux to the Nintendo DS game console. DSLinux includes drivers for the WiFi hardware in the DS, allowing the use of telnet and the retawq Web browser.

Download Website Updated 16 Apr 2007 MPEG Audio/Video Player

Screenshot
Pop 31.61
Vit 2.85

MPEG Audio/Video Player is a simple MPEG and AC3 player for Linux, BSD, and Windows systems. It plays MPEG transport, program, and elementary stream files. It also has basic DVD support (using libdvdnav on Linux/BSD systems only). It features newly developed integer decoders for MPEG 1&2 video, MPEG layer 2 audio, and AC3 audio. It includes a partially working WMV/VC1 decoder capable of displaying I and P frames.

Download Website Updated 01 Jun 2011 Coreboot

Screenshot
Pop 231.41
Vit 15.73

Coreboot (formerly known as LinuxBIOS) is a project that aims to replace the normal BIOS with a little bit of hardware initialization and a payload. Payloads can include a compressed Linux kernel, FILO, GRUB2, OpenBIOS, Open Firmware, SmartFirmware, GNUFI (UEFI), Etherboot, ADLO (for booting Windows and OpenBSD), Plan 9, or memtest86.

Download Website Updated 03 Feb 2012 Buenos

Screenshot
Pop 18.57
Vit 3.34

Buenos is a small SMP operating system skeleton that can be used as a base for operating systems project courses. The system is intended to be used as OS project base code which students can improve. Extensive documentation with suggestions for assignments or exercises is included with the system. It runs in a machine simulator called YAMS, which is its sister project.

No download Website Updated 06 Jan 2014 Fiwix

Screenshot
Pop 111.71
Vit 24.25

Fiwix is an operating system kernel based on the Unix architecture and fully focused on being Linux compatible. It is designed exclusively for educational purposes, so the kernel code is kept as simple as possible for the benefit of students. It runs on the 32-bit x86 hardware platform, and is compatible with a good base of existing GNU applications.

No download Website Updated 15 May 2006 SheepShaver

Screenshot
Pop 31.86
Vit 1.45

SheepShaver is a free, portable, feature-rich, PowerPC Mac emulator. It runs MacOS 7.5.2 up to MacOS 9.0.4, but it requires a copy of a 4 MB or NewWorld Mac ROM.

Screenshot

Project Spotlight

grep

GNU grep, egrep and fgrep.

Screenshot

Project Spotlight

Packet Peeper

A network protocol analyzer for Mac OS X.